Job Summary

Provide specialized wound care under established protocols, including assessment, treatment, patient/family education, and documentation. Collaborate with providers and nursing staff to reduce infection risk, promote skin integrity, and support optimal outcomes.

Key Responsibilities

  • Perform comprehensive wound assessments, linear measurements, photography per policy, and staging/classification; update plans of care.
  • Complete sterile and non-sterile dressing changes; apply topical agents/ointments; manage drainage devices/pouches.
  • Provide conservative sharp debridement and silver nitrate application as indicated; irrigate/cleanse wounds; obtain quantitative swab cultures.
  • Initiate and monitor negative pressure wound therapy (NPWT/VAC); apply venous compression wraps; support whirlpool/hydrotherapy as ordered.
  • Perform diabetic foot exams; complete ankle-brachial index (ABI) testing to guide treatment.
  • Educate patients/families on prevention, treatment, and rehabilitation; document all teaching and responses.
  • Maintain infection prevention and safety standards; participate in wound care education/in-services; document thoroughly in the EHR.

Job Qualifications

Required

  • Current Arkansas RN license (or compact eligible); BLS
  • Ability to read, write, speak, and understand English; strong documentation and communication skills.

Preferred

  • Wound certification (e.g., WOCN/CWCN, WCC, OMS) or commitment to obtain.
  • Recent experience with conservative sharp debridement, NPWT/VAC, venous compression, and complex/chronic wound management.
  • Experience performing ABI testing and diabetic foot assessments.
